SA 1553. Mr. MORAN (for himself and Mr. Kaine) submitted an amendment
intended to be proposed to amendment SA 1502 proposed by Mr. Schumer to
the bill S. 1260, to establish a new Directorate for Technology and
Innovation in the National Science Foundation, to establish a regional
technology hub program, to require a strategy and report on economic
security, science, research, innovation, manufacturing, and job
creation, to establish a critical supply chain resiliency program, and
for other purposes; which was ordered to lie on the table; as follows:
At the appropriate place, insert the following:
SEC. ___. SENSE OF CONGRESS ON THE EXPORTATION OF SURPLUS
COVID-19 VACCINES TO COUNTRIES IN NEED.
It is the sense of Congress that the Secretary of State, in
coordination with the Secretary of Health and Human Services
and the Administrator of the United States Agency for
International Development, should--
(1) immediately engage in multilateral and bilateral
negotiations to provide surplus COVID-19 vaccines held by the
United States to countries in need of such vaccines with the
best opportunity for impact;
(2) evaluate the perception of people throughout the world
regarding--
(A) the efforts made by the United States to supply COVID-
19 vaccines to countries in need of such vaccines; and
(B) the contributions made by other countries to supply
COVID-19 vaccines to countries in need of such vaccines; and
(3) integrate public diplomacy with the technical response
to the worldwide COVID-19 vaccine shortage to the fullest
extent practicable.
